Jadual Kandungan
Apa yang boleh anda lakukan dengan pereka?
Cara mengakses pereka dalam phpmyadmin
Petua untuk menggunakan pereka dengan berkesan
Bilakah pereka yang paling berguna?
Rumah pangkalan data phpMyAdmin Apakah ciri 'pereka' dalam phpmyadmin, dan bagaimanakah ia dapat menggambarkan hubungan skema pangkalan data?

Apakah ciri 'pereka' dalam phpmyadmin, dan bagaimanakah ia dapat menggambarkan hubungan skema pangkalan data?

Jul 08, 2025 am 12:32 AM

Ciri "pereka" phpmyadmin adalah alat visualisasi yang membantu pengguna memahami dan menguruskan hubungan antara jadual dalam pangkalan data MySQL atau MariaDB. Ia secara grafik memaparkan struktur jadual, sambungan kunci asing, menyokong tag dan anotasi tersuai, menyediakan pandangan skema pangkalan data intuitif, dan membolehkan pengguna untuk menyesuaikan susun atur secara interaktif. Untuk menggunakan ciri ini, pastikan pangkalan data menggunakan enjin InnoDB dan mempunyai kekangan utama asing yang ditakrifkan, maka anda boleh memasukkan antara muka dengan memilih pangkalan data dan mengklik tab "Pereka" di bahagian atas. Untuk menggunakan pereka dengan berkesan, anda harus memastikan bahawa kunci asing ditetapkan dengan betul, gunakan fungsi seret dan drop untuk mengoptimumkan susun atur, menyimpan susunan semasa, dan menambah komen untuk meningkatkan kebolehbacaan. Alat ini amat berguna apabila menyahpepijat pertanyaan kompleks, penulisan dokumen, dan membina semula struktur pangkalan data warisan. Ia sesuai untuk senario pangkalan data bersaiz sederhana dengan sedikit hubungan yang jelas.

Ciri "pereka" dalam phpmyadmin adalah alat visual yang membantu pengguna memahami dan menguruskan hubungan antara jadual dalam pangkalan data MySQL atau MariaDB. Ia amat berguna untuk pangkalan data dengan pelbagai jadual yang saling berkaitan, kerana ia memberikan perwakilan skematik bagaimana mereka dihubungkan melalui kunci asing.

Apa yang boleh anda lakukan dengan pereka?

Pada terasnya, pereka memberi anda susun atur visual skema pangkalan data anda. Ini termasuk:

  • Menunjukkan struktur jadual (lajur, jenis data)
  • Memaparkan hubungan utama asing sebagai garis menghubungkan jadual
  • Membiarkan anda menyusun semula jadual secara visual untuk membaca yang lebih baik
  • Menyokong nota atau label tersuai untuk dokumentasi

Ia bukan sekadar pandangan pasif - anda juga boleh menyesuaikan garis hubungan, menambah komen ke jadual, dan juga mengubahsuai beberapa sifat secara langsung dari antara muka.

Cara mengakses pereka dalam phpmyadmin

Untuk menggunakan pereka, anda perlu bekerja dalam pangkalan data yang mempunyai jadual menggunakan enjin penyimpanan InnoDB dan kekangan utama asing yang ditakrifkan. Sebaik sahaja mereka ditubuhkan, inilah cara mengakses alat:

  • Log masuk ke phpmyadmin
  • Pilih pangkalan data dari menu kiri
  • Klik pada tab "Pereka" di bahagian atas halaman

Jika tab Pereka tidak muncul, periksa sama ada konfigurasi anda membenarkannya - kadang -kadang perlu diaktifkan secara manual dalam fail config.inc.php .

Petua untuk menggunakan pereka dengan berkesan

Berikut adalah beberapa perkara yang perlu diingat semasa bekerja dengan pereka:

  • Kekunci asing mesti ditakrifkan dengan betul - jika jadual tidak disambungkan melalui kunci asing, pereka tidak akan menunjukkan sebarang hubungan.
  • Gunakan drag-and-drop untuk mengatur susun atur -anda boleh memindahkan jadual di sekitar untuk menjadikan rajah lebih mudah dibaca.
  • Simpan susun atur anda - Pereka membolehkan anda menyimpan susunan semasa supaya anda tidak perlu meletakkan semula jadual setiap kali.
  • Tambah Nota Untuk Kejelasan - Anda boleh memasukkan kotak teks untuk menerangkan bahagian kompleks skema anda.

Juga, ambil perhatian bahawa walaupun pereka membantu memvisualisasikan struktur, ia tidak menyokong ciri pemodelan lanjutan seperti kejuruteraan terbalik atau menghasilkan skrip SQL dari rajah.

Bilakah pereka yang paling berguna?

Alat ini benar-benar bersinar apabila anda berurusan dengan pangkalan data bersaiz sederhana di mana hubungan pemahaman jadual tidak segera jelas hanya dengan melihat senarai jadual.

Contohnya:

  • Debugging bergabung dalam pertanyaan yang kompleks
  • Mendokumentasikan pangkalan data untuk pemaju baru
  • Refactoring struktur pangkalan data warisan

Ia mungkin tidak cukup kuat untuk pemodelan peringkat perusahaan, tetapi untuk kebanyakan aplikasi web yang dibina dengan PHP dan MySQL, ia berfungsi dengan baik.

Pada dasarnya itu sahaja.

Atas ialah kandungan terperinci Apakah ciri 'pereka' dalam phpmyadmin, dan bagaimanakah ia dapat menggambarkan hubungan skema pangkalan data?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n

Alat AI Hot

Undress AI Tool

Undress AI Tool

Gambar buka pakaian secara percuma

Undresser.AI Undress

Undresser.AI Undress

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over

AI Clothes Remover

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Clothoff.io

Clothoff.io

Penyingkiran pakaian AI

Video Face Swap

Video Face Swap

Tukar muka dalam mana-mana video dengan mudah menggunakan alat tukar muka AI percuma kami!

Alat panas

Notepad++7.3.1

Notepad++7.3.1

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ina

SublimeText3 versi Cina

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1

Hantar Studio 13.0.1

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6

Dreamweaver CS6

Alat pembangunan web visual

SublimeText3 versi Mac

SublimeText3 versi Mac

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as

Tutorial PHP
1517
276
Bagaimanakah phpmyadmin paparan dan membenarkan penyuntingan nilai lalai dan sifat auto_increment untuk lajur? Bagaimanakah phpmyadmin paparan dan membenarkan penyuntingan nilai lalai dan sifat auto_increment untuk lajur? Jul 23, 2025 am 04:19 AM

phpmyadmindisplaysandallowseditingofcolumndefaultsandauto-incrementsettingsThoughTheThetableStructureview.1.DefaultValuesareshowninthe lajur "lalai", di mana lajur, di mana-mana lajur, di mana-mana

Bagaimanakah phpmyadmin mengendalikan data binari (gumpalan) semasa memaparkan atau mengedit kandungan jadual? Bagaimanakah phpmyadmin mengendalikan data binari (gumpalan) semasa memaparkan atau mengedit kandungan jadual? Jul 20, 2025 am 04:12 AM

Cara phpmyadmin mengendalikan data gumpalan adalah praktikal tetapi terhad. 1. Apabila melihat lajur gumpalan, ruang letak seperti [BLOB-25B] biasanya dipaparkan untuk mengelakkan secara langsung memberikan kandungan besar atau tidak boleh dibaca; Untuk gumpalan jenis teks (seperti JSON), anda boleh mengklik untuk melihat kandungan tertentu. 2. Apabila mengedit medan gumpalan, gumpalan jenis teks kecil boleh diedit melalui kotak teks, manakala gumpalan besar atau binari (seperti gambar) tidak boleh diedit dalam talian dan perlu digantikan dengan memuat turun atau memuat naik fail. 3. Pilihan Konfigurasi $ CFG ['DisplayBinaryAshex'], $ CFG ['DisplayBlob'] dan $ CFG ['SaveCellSatonce'] boleh mengawal BL

Cara mengemas kini phpmyadmin Cara mengemas kini phpmyadmin Aug 02, 2025 am 06:57 AM

CheckyourinstallationMethodTodeterminethecorrectupdateApproach.2.forpackageManagerInstallations, usesudoaptupdateandoaptupgradephpmyadminorreinstall.3.FormatualUpdates, muat turun, muat turun -muat turun,

Bagaimanakah saya boleh menetapkan set aksara lalai untuk pangkalan data atau jadual baru yang dibuat melalui phpmyadmin? Bagaimanakah saya boleh menetapkan set aksara lalai untuk pangkalan data atau jadual baru yang dibuat melalui phpmyadmin? Jul 23, 2025 am 03:34 AM

Untuk menetapkan set aksara lalai untuk pangkalan data atau jadual baru dalam phpmyadmin, anda harus terlebih dahulu menetapkan set aksara lalai global dan peraturan pengumpulan dengan mengubah fail konfigurasi pelayan MySQL. Sebagai contoh, tambahkan aksara-set-server = UTF8MB4 dan collation-server = UTF8MB4_UNICODE_CI dalam /etc/my.cnf atau C: \ ProgramData \ mysql \ mysqlserverx.y \ my.ini, dan kemudian mulakan semula perkhidmatan MySQL; Kedua, apabila membuat pangkalan data baru dalam phpmyadmin, anda harus memilih peraturan pengumpulan yang sepadan dalam menu drop-down "Collation".

Bagaimanakah phpmyadmin memaparkan jenis data GIS (sistem maklumat geografi)? Bagaimanakah phpmyadmin memaparkan jenis data GIS (sistem maklumat geografi)? Jul 21, 2025 am 02:37 AM

Phpmyadmin menyokong paparan data spatial melalui visualisasi GIS terbina dalam, dan menggunakan API OpenLayers dan Googlemaps untuk melaksanakan rendering peta. 1. 2. Menyediakan halaman tab "GIS" apabila melayari jadual, menggunakan OpenLayers untuk memaparkan peta dan menyokong lapisan berbilang lapisan; 3. Menyediakan editor grafik untuk memasukkan atau mengubah suai data ruang tanpa memasuki WKT secara manual; 4. Menyokong mengeksport data spatial di Geojson, KML dan format lain, sesuai untuk alat luaran seperti QGIS dan Leaflet.js. Walaupun bukan sistem GIS yang lengkap, ia menyediakan

Cara memberikan keistimewaan kepada pengguna di phpmyadmin Cara memberikan keistimewaan kepada pengguna di phpmyadmin Jul 24, 2025 am 03:45 AM

Logintophpmyadminwithanadminaccountandgotothe "userAccounts" atau "keistimewaan" tab.2.EditanExistuserorAddanewonebyClicking "EditPrivileges" atau "AddUseraccount" .3.AssignGlobalParegesungereder "GlobalPrivileges

Bagaimanakah phpmyadmin mengendalikan mod SQL yang berbeza pada pelayan MySQL? Bagaimanakah phpmyadmin mengendalikan mod SQL yang berbeza pada pelayan MySQL? Jul 20, 2025 am 04:11 AM

phpmyadmindoesnotenforceitsownsqlmodeButRespectsThesqlmodesetonthemysqlserver.1.itsendssqlcommandsdirectlytothemysqlserver, Wh erebehaviordepledtanTheActivesqlmode.2.ifstrictModeisenabled, phpmyadminwillshowerrorsforinvaluesinsinsteadofsillyadjusti

Bagaimanakah phpmyadmin boleh digunakan untuk memantau trafik pelayan dan statistik pertanyaan? Bagaimanakah phpmyadmin boleh digunakan untuk memantau trafik pelayan dan statistik pertanyaan? Jul 21, 2025 am 02:44 AM

Untuk menggunakan phpmyAdmin untuk melihat trafik pelayan dan statistik pertanyaan, sila beroperasi mengikut urutan: 1. Klik tab "Status" untuk melihat data masa nyata seperti gambaran, trafik, statistik pertanyaan, dan sambungan; 2. Semak konfigurasi utama seperti max_connections dan thread_cache_size dalam tab "pembolehubah" untuk membantu dalam prestasi analisis; 3. Jika log pertanyaan perlahan diaktifkan, cari pautan "pertanyaan perlahan" dalam "status" untuk akses; 4. Gunakan tab "Operasi" untuk memantau bilangan baris dan penyimpanan jadual tertentu. Walaupun ciri -ciri ini bukan alat pemantauan profesional, mereka sesuai untuk mendiagnosis beban pangkalan data dan masalah prestasi dengan cepat.

See all articles